Episode 61: Dr. Vincent Martin and Dr. Lindsay Weitzel discuss Vestibular Migraine in Episode 61 of Heads UP. Do you experience dizziness, vertigo, lightheadedness? You could be experiencing Vestibular Migraine.

@@iambreannaa so sorry I am just seeing this! I am currently on a low dosage of clonazapam daily, which acts as a vestibular suppressant. It has improved my symptoms by about 70 percent. Mainly my balance, which has allowed me to exercise again and get back to a little more of a normal active life. I’ve lost 35 lbs of the 40+ I put on due to not being able to exercise because of my equilibrium being so bad...I’m currently continuing to try other medications. Most recently, I tried topiramate, which put me in a fog and made me sooo sleepy. I am about to try a couple more: Ubrelvy and NURTEC, which are both calcitonin gene-related peptide receptor antagonists (CGRPs). They are supposed to work by targeting and blocking CGRP, which is found in many people with migraines, but we’ll have to see how they do, since I don’t have typical migraines with a headache or anything.
